This NSN is assigned to Item Name Code (INC) 32068. [AN ARRANGEMENT OF MULTIPLE FIXED RESISTIVE ELEMENTS OR DISCRETE RESISTORS PERMANENTLY ENCASED, ENCAPSULATED, OR POTTED TOGETHER, TO FORM AN INSEPARABLE UNIT. THE RESISTIVE ELEMENTS, CONSISTING OF A THIN LAYER OF CONDUCTIVE MATERIAL DEPOSITED ON OR FUSED TO AN INSULATING BASE, USUALLY ARE ELECTRICALLY CONNECTED TO EACH OTHER AND MAY BE ARRANGED IN ANY CIRCUIT CONFIGURATION. EXCLUDES:RESISTOR, FIXED (AS MODIFIED); RESISTOR ASSEMBLY; RESISTOR NETWORK, FIXED-VARIABLE; AND RESISTOR SET, MATCHED.].
